Exploring Knossos Palace After the Guided Tour

heraklion-guided-tour-of-the-city-and-knossos-palace-ticket

After the guided tour, visitors can explore Knossos Palace at their own pace.

At their own leisure, visitors can explore the ancient Minoan ruins of Knossos Palace after a guided tour.

The skip-the-line ticket allows them to enter the archaeological site without waiting in line. Guests can wander through the ancient Minoan ruins, learning about the civilization’s advanced architecture and culture.

Highlights include the grand Palace of Knossos, the Throne Room, and the remarkable frescoes.

Visitors have the freedom to discover the site’s rich history and significance at their leisure. This self-guided exploration complements the informative city tour, providing a well-rounded experience of Heraklion’s historic landmarks.
